So, What Is Bacteriostatic Water Anyway?

Alright, quick and simple.

Bacteriostatic water is basically sterile water with a small preservative added to it. In research settings, it is often used when preparing or handling materials that need a clean, controlled environment.

Nothing fancy on the surface.

But here is the thing... it needs to be consistent. Every time.

Because in research, we are not just “trying things out.” We are trying to observe, compare, repeat. And for that, we need materials that behave the same way again and again.

Frequently Asked Questions (FAQs)

1. What is bacteriostatic water used for in research?

It is commonly used as a sterile diluent in research settings where controlled conditions are important.

2. Why is sourcing bacteriostatic water from a reliable supplier important?

Because it helps ensure consistency, proper handling, and clear information about the product.

3. What should researchers check before purchasing bacteriostatic water?

Things like product details, labeling, storage information, and overall transparency from the supplier.

4. Is all bacteriostatic water the same?

Not always. Differences can come from how it is made, stored, and handled.

5. Can poor-quality research materials affect laboratory work?

Yes, they can introduce uncertainty and make results harder to understand or repeat.
